#982618 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#982618 is composed of 59.6% red, 14.9%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75% magenta, 84.2%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 6.6 degrees, a saturation of 72.7% and a lightness of 34.5%. #982618 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4c30 with #310000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#982618 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#982618 has RGB values of R:152, G:38,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.84,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 9971224.

Shades and Tints of #982618
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100403 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
